Abstract: We prove that the non-commutative Gross-Neveu model on the two-dimensional Moyal plane is renormalizable to all orders. Despite a remaining UV/IR mixing, renormalizability can be achieved. However, in the massive case, this forces us to introduce an additional counterterm of the form "psibar i gamma^{0} gamma^{1} psi". The massless case is renormalizable without such an addition.
